Since i switched my mail to thunderbird the junk mail filter has never really worked. I want the junk mail to get put into the junk folder just like it did in outlook.
My settings are as follows:

However, the junk mail it detects does not get put in the junk folder, it just stays in the inbox, with a little fire logo in the junk column. What gives?

Also, is the junk mail detection in this just stupid or am I doing something wrong? It keeps flagging innocent mail as junk, even if I have specifically pressed the 'not junk' button on mails sent previously from the same sender.
 
The first screenshot tells me that when YOU mark an email as spam it will send it to the Junk folder for your email account.

However the second screenshot will send spam to the Junk folder in the Local Folders.

Check the 'Other:' radio button and choose your Junk folder for email account rather than the Local Folders one.

Secondly what is your email provider? That might be letting spam in depending on the strength of the spam filter setting. My Fastmail account, for example, lets me choose how strong to filter out spam. The stronger the spam filter, the less spam I actually see and the more likely I am to suffer non-spam emails being considered spam.

Anyways change those settings like I said. Perhaps also check out the log and see if you can see anything dodgy going on in there that explains this.
